Firms chronically underinsured, warns Allianz
Just 55% of businesses are confident they are properly covered by insurance should the worst happen, according to new research from Allianz Insurance.Allianz warns that record numbers of businesses could find themselves underinsured in 2011, with potentially significant consequences should they need to make a claim.The research identified that many ...
